Slope landscaping services involve shaping and grading the land to create a stable, functional, and attractive outdoor space. This process typically includes leveling uneven areas, creating gentle slopes, and ensuring proper drainage to prevent water pooling or erosion.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to contour the terrain, making sure that the slope directs water away from foundations and other structures. Proper grading not only enhances the appearance of a yard but also helps maintain its integrity over time, reducing the risk of future issues caused by poor drainage or soil movement.
These services are especially helpful for homeowners dealing with yards that have significant inclines, uneven terrain, or areas prone to water runoff problems. Sloped landscapes can lead to soil erosion, muddy patches, or water damage if not properly managed. Slope landscaping can address these issues by creating a well-planned grade that directs water flow away from the house and landscaping features. It can also improve safety by reducing trip hazards associated with uneven ground and creating a more accessible outdo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Slope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bountiful, UT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slope repairs or small landscaping adjustments us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and materials involved.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Mid-Range Projects - Larger slope modifications or partial landscape renovations often c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king significant improvements without full replacement.
Full Slope Replacement - Complete slope replacements or extensive landscaping can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ent but are necessary for severe erosion or major redesigns.
Complex or Custom Jobs - Highly customized or complex slope work involving specialized materials or unique site conditions can exceed $10,000. These are typically larger, more involved projects handled by experienced local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of landscaping services do local contractors provide for slopes? Local contractors offer a range of services including grading, retaining wall installation, erosion control, and slope stabilization to improve the safety and appearance of sloped areas.
How can slope landscaping improve the stability of a hillside? Slope landscaping can enhance stability through techniques like terracing, planting ground cover, and installing retaining structures that prevent erosion and landslides.
Are there specific plants suitable for hillside landscaping in Bountiful, UT? Yes, local service providers can recommend native and drought-tolerant plants that thrive on slopes and help reduce erosion in the area.
What considerations are important when designing slope landscaping? Factors such as soil type, drainage, slope angle, and the intended use of the space are important to ensure a durable and functional landscape design.
How do local contractors handle erosion control on steep slopes? They often implement measures like installing erosion barriers, planting stabilizing vegetation, and constructing retaining walls to manage runoff and prevent soil loss.
